為了在運(yùn)行下面的程序之后得到輸出16,鍵盤輸入x應(yīng)該是(    )
INPUT x
IF  x<0  THEN
y=(x+1)*(x+1)
ELSE
y=(x-1)*(x-1)
END IF
PRINT y
END
A.3或-3B.-5C.5或-3D.5或-5
D

試題分析:因?yàn)楦鶕?jù)已知條件,可知程序表示的為條件語句下的分段函數(shù)
 
那么當(dāng)輸出結(jié)果為16時(shí),則有=16,x=5,當(dāng)=16,則x=-5,都符合定義域,因此可之選D.
點(diǎn)評(píng):解決該試題的關(guān)鍵是理解條件語句,表示的為分段函數(shù),然后根據(jù)輸出的函數(shù)值,求解自變量的值,屬于基礎(chǔ)題。
練習(xí)冊(cè)系列答案
相關(guān)習(xí)題

科目:高中數(shù)學(xué) 來源:不詳 題型:填空題

下左程序運(yùn)行后輸出的結(jié)果為_________________________.

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:單選題

以下程序的功能是(  )
S=1;
for i=1:1:10
S=(3^i)*S;
end
S
A.計(jì)算3×10的值B.計(jì)算355的值
C.計(jì)算310的值D.計(jì)算1×2×3×…×10的值

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:單選題

對(duì)一位運(yùn)動(dòng)員的心臟跳動(dòng)檢測(cè)了8次,得到如下表所示的數(shù)據(jù):
檢測(cè)次數(shù)
1
2
3
4
5
6
7
8
檢測(cè)數(shù)據(jù)(次/分鐘)
39
40
42
42
43
45
46
47
上述數(shù)據(jù)的統(tǒng)計(jì)分析中,一部分計(jì)算見如圖所示的程序框圖(其中是這8個(gè)數(shù)據(jù)的平均數(shù)),則輸出的的值是(   )

A.6    B.7     C.8   D.56

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:單選題

如圖所示的程序框圖所表示的算法是
A.12+22+32+…+102
B.102+112+122+…+10002
C.102+202+302+…+10002
D.12+22+32+…+10002

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:解答題

計(jì)算并輸出1×2×3×4×﹣﹣﹣×n>1000的最小整數(shù)n,寫出程序框圖,并編寫程序。

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:填空題

執(zhí)行如圖所示的程序框圖,則輸出=______.

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:填空題

下右程序輸出的n的值是_________________.

查看答案和解析>>

科目:高中數(shù)學(xué) 來源:不詳 題型:填空題

比較大。    

查看答案和解析>>

同步練習(xí)冊(cè)答案